Find my iPhone is gone

My son has an iphone 4. Not an "S". We enabled find my iphone so I can keep tabs. He's aware of it and it was part of the agreement to get this phone. But last week when I attempt to locate him on my phone (a 4S) the rest of the house iphones come up but his says "no location available." He and I looked at his phone and went in to settings and cant find the "find my iphone" prompt anywhere. He says he did nothing to disable it, and we cant figure how to enable it again. Help? Thanks
